Output 25552c264f105799642ccea99187905a87873ae0f0709ac8b2a7b7f755aa29e1:1

value
6380669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22007e905588426909f91c18f65431039642240e OP_EQUAL
address
34noVR8MxDpti5k9fPfqwpZ87hpNZM2p5M
transaction
25552c264f105799642ccea99187905a87873ae0f0709ac8b2a7b7f755aa29e1
spent
true